About The Position

CAP Government, Inc. is seeking the immediate hire of licensed Building Plans Examiner and Inspector needed for inspection and plan review services of construction projects. The work involves the interpretation and application of these regulations as applied to customer relations, the review of building construction blues, product approvals, shop drawings and other project documents. Some travel may be required for inspections and/or managing projects in the assigned area. Candidates must possess a professional demeanor, have both technical and industry experience, and be a team player.

Requirements

  • Licensed General Contractor's for a minimum of five (5) years; and
  • State of Florida Plan Review License (PX) in building; or
  • State of Florida Inspector License (BN) in building, or
  • ICC Residential & Commercial Plans Examiner and/ or Inspection certification in building; and
  • Must be certified or certifiable as a Building Plans Examiner by the Miami Dade and/or the Broward County Board of Rules and Appeals (BORA).
  • Must have knowledge of the Florida Building Code and other regulations pertaining to construction and development.
  • Ability to understand and interpret codes and evaluate project proposals and projects under construction to verify conformance with code requirements.
